Did you know that Dani Parejo, despite being a deep-lying midfielder, has consistently been among the top assist providers in La Liga for many seasons?
His most defining career moment was captaining Valencia CF to their first major trophy in 11 years, winning the Copa del Rey in 2019 against FC Barcelona. This triumph solidified his status as a club legend and a true leader on the field.
Parejo's legacy is defined by his exceptional vision, precise passing, and leadership as one of La Liga's premier deep-lying playmakers. He is remembered as a midfield orchestrator who consistently dictated the tempo of the game.
